Vodacom cites 'fault' for disappearing data

Hundreds of South Africans have taken to social media
complaining of disappearing data bundles and airtime this evening.
![Cellphone](https://turntable.kagiso.io/images/cell-phone-690192_960_720.width-800.jpg)
Many claim to have bought data only to receive a data depletion notification SMS just moments later.
Some have also complained of disappearing airtime.
Disgruntled data users seem to have used their last data to express their frustration with the network provider.

If you ever want to make a South African angry, take away something they have paid for.
Vodacom has since issued a short statement of sorts in response to the stream of complaints.
Hi Khanyi, our technicians are working hard to remedy the fault. Thank you for your patience
— Vodacom (@Vodacom) August 21, 2017
Vodacom is committed to ensuring that all affected customers will be refunded in full. Thanks again for your patience.
— Vodacom (@Vodacom) August 21, 2017
However, their response fails to truly explain the reasons behind the data disappearing.
